根据音频识别不同的语种
时间: 2024-04-01 19:35:56 浏览: 14
进行语种检测可以得到音频中所使用的语言,通常的方法是基于声音信号的语音特征来进行识别。以下是一些常用的语种检测方法:
1. 基于概率模型:使用概率模型对不同语言的声音特征进行建模,通过计算模型下输入信号的概率来进行语种分类。
2. 基于语音特征:对音频信号提取语音特征,如音调、音频频率、能量和谐波等,再通过对比不同语言的特征差异来进行语种分类。
3. 基于深度学习:使用深度神经网络对输入的音频信号进行建模,并通过分类器对不同语言的特征进行分类。
目前,有许多开源的语种检测工具可供使用,如Google的语言识别API、百度语音识别API等。这些工具可以帮助我们快速地进行语种检测,并提供准确的语种判断结果。
相关问题
chatglm 语音识别
chatglm语音识别是一种先进的语音识别技术,可以将人类的语音转换为文本或命令,实现人机交互。它通过复杂的算法和模型识别语音的音频信号,并将其转换为可理解的文本或指令,以便计算机系统可以理解和执行。chatglm语音识别技术可以广泛应用于语音助手、智能音箱、电话客服、语音搜索等领域。
该技术通过使用神经网络和机器学习算法来不断提高自身的识别能力,并可以适应不同的语音特征和口音。这使得chatglm语音识别在多语种、多方言环境下都有良好的识别效果。同时,它还可以识别并理解语音中的情感和语气,从而提高对话交互的自然度和准确性。
chatglm语音识别技术在日常生活中得到了广泛的应用,如语音搜索、语音输入、语音翻译等。它也在商业领域中得到了广泛的运用,如电话客服自动接听、语音助手智能对话、智能音箱智能控制等。未来,chatglm语音识别技术有望进一步提升识别准确度和速度,实现更加智能和自然的人机交互。
unity百度ai语音识别
Unity百度AI语音识别是一款基于Unity引擎和百度AI技术的语音识别插件。通过该插件,开发者可以在Unity开发环境中轻松地将语音识别功能集成到自己的游戏、应用或项目中。
Unity百度AI语音识别插件提供了多种功能和服务。首先,它具备高精度的语音识别能力,可以将用户的输入语音转换为文本,实现语音与文字的转化。其次,该插件还支持多语种的语音识别,可以满足不同地区和用户的需求。此外,它还提供了实时音量和能量回调功能,开发者可以根据音频的实时状态进行相应的处理。除此之外,Unity百度AI语音识别还有多种设置选项,例如设置识别模式、识别音频格式等,以适应不同的应用场景和需求。
通过使用Unity百度AI语音识别插件,开发者可以使自己的游戏或应用具备语音交互的功能,从而提升用户体验和交互性。用户可以通过语音输入来进行游戏控制、文字输入或语音搜索等操作,使得使用更加便捷和智能化。而且,插件的集成和使用也非常简便,开发者只需要在Unity中导入相关资源,调用相应的API接口即可实现语音识别功能。
总的来说,Unity百度AI语音识别插件为Unity开发者提供了一种灵活、高效的语音识别解决方案,使得开发者能够方便地将语音识别功能应用到自己的项目中,并改善用户的交互体验。